Do Games presents the next installment of the Mystical Riddles series with Mystical Riddles: Behind Doll Eyes!

As a paranormal detective, you’re no stranger to a touch of the supernatural in your cases. Still, after responding to a call from a concerned mother about her son’s fiancée’s suspicious behavior, you quickly find that things aren’t exactly as they seem, and the truth you discover makes your blood run cold. You’ll have to gather all your courage to follow the many twists and turns as you race to uncover the secrets behind a family wrapped up in dark forces. Find out what happens to lost spirits and what really lies Behind Doll Eyes in this haunting Hidden-Object adventure!

This is a special Collector's Edition release full of exclusive extras you won’t find in the standard version.

The Collector’s Edition includes:
  • Exclusive bonus chapter with an all-new story!
  • Ten additional scenes!
  • Exciting new puzzles and Hidden-Object scenes!
  • Tons of extra collectibles!
  • Downloadable wallpapers, concept art, and music from the game!

REVIEW BASED UPON THE ENTIRE GAME
4 Chapters Plus a Bonus Chapter – Strategy Guide: 45 pages
Kudos to DO Games for another “phantasmic” spookfest! Enjoy a ghostly jaunt into the world of the paranormal as a detective with your own agency, Mystical Riddles. Your companions on these two haunts will be from the ghostly realm. In the main game, help a future mother-in-law discover why her future daughter-in-law gives her goosebumps and why she seems so cold to her. Although her son considers her as a real doll, mom is less impressed. In the bonus chapter, help a neurotic husband locate his wife. And if this hubby seems somewhat strange, there is a reason!
DO Games is my favorite HOPA developer, providing more game value for the money and this game is no exception. I loved the storylines in both the main game and the bonus chapter. I found the pace excellent with fun-filled activities throughout the game. There are many extras in this developer’s games which other developers do not provide. For me, I cannot wait to play the games from DO Games.
The gaming format is the same as in all this developer’s other games. There are three collectibles. They include morphing runes, dolls, and photographs which can be exchanged to outfit a boudoir at the end of the game. You get a gimmicky camera which takes photos of the world of the paranormal. Just push the button every time you see a glimmering light. As in the last game you have the option to add more game footage – this time it is meandering around a doll house and within the basement of a forest cabin. I love this new option within this developer’s games.
MECHANICS:
• Four (4) levels of play including a customized version.
• 44 achievements.
• Collect 15 dolls and 15 morphing runes.
• Collect 59 snapshots which can be traded to items to deck out a boudoir
• 10 wallpapers along with concept art, music, and video sequences
• Replay 21 HOP scenes and 18 Mind Games
• Gimmicky camera to take pictures of the paranormal
BONUS CHAPTER: It is a different story than from the main game. Play the paranormal detective in solving yet another case. Help a husband locate his wife who is missing. Also, help a ghostly green hound from the underworld who is trying to collect a wayward soul. There are five (5) HOP scenes and seven (7) mind games (AKA puzzles). This chapter is a wonderful addition to the main game. I felt the activities were equal in quality to those in the main game.
HOP SCENES: There are twenty-one (21) scenes, all of which can be replayed upon completion of the game. The scenes are very creatively designed. All are interactive and two of them have puzzles within the scene. As in previous games, the player can play a Match-3 game instead of the HOP scenes. These are some of the best HOP scenes out there and all are somewhat puzzle-like. There are only two standard lists of items (which I find boring). There is a variety of different styles. There are scenes with cryptic clues, rebus clues, and matching. There are the usual storybook scenes with silhouetted items to be located. The player will also discover a scene in which items which are out of place must be identified, and once clicked, return to their proper position. For me, this developer’s HOP scenes are creative works of art.
MIND GAMES: There are thirty-three (33) puzzles, eighteen (18) of which can be replayed upon completion of the game. As in other games, most of the puzzles can be played in either an easy or a hard mode. I love the phrase “mind games.” However, even the “harder mind games” are not terribly challenging. I only wish that this developer would provide more of these puzzles to be replayed upon completion of the game.
SPOILERS: HERE ARE SOME OF THE MIND GAMES FROM THIS GAME (E = Easy; H = Hard)
A. E/H. Strategy/Physics puzzle. Set the value on shut off valves so that the pressure causes a ball to go from one end of a pipe to the other. The easy version has 5 valves and the hard has 6.
B. E/H. Sequence puzzle. Enter a code to open a chest by using pointers to select and place tokens into slots at the bottom of the grid in sequential order. The easy version has 3 tokens to place while the hard has 5
C. E/H. Maze Escape puzzle. Move through a maze choosing between 3 routes at the proper time to escape ghosts. 3X
D. E/H. Assembly puzzle. Place cutlery into position into a suitcase so all fit without overlapping. Easy version has an easier arrangement than the hard version.
E. E/H. Pant by Number puzzle. In this case, paint by symbol. Paint a picture with paints matching symbols within the scene. The hard version has symbols which morph in and out of the picture.
F. E/H. Maze puzzle. Move 2 minecarts to houses of the same color removing obstacles along the way. Alternate between the carts to remove obstacles to open paths. The hard version has more obstacles.
G. E/H. Assembly puzzle. Neat puzzle in which you guess 8 animals being portrayed by hand shadows. In the hard version, the animals are divided into segments; the player must click on all the animal segments to remove them.
H. Switch puzzle. On four tokens, each with 4 different colored segments, rotate the tokens to change the position of their segments until each of the four has segments of the same color.
BONUS CHAPTER:
I. Map puzzle. Move 4 pieces of a tiara to their matching slots at the side of a grid. Move them on a 11 x 6 grid with rotating tree roots. Keep the pieces from hitting the tree roots while moving them to their slots.
J. E/H. Strategy puzzle. On a grid, press on squares with up to 5 dots on them to throw dirt on a fire. The dots indicate how many squares it can extinguish. The easy grid as 25 squares and the hard 36 squares.

Another winner from Domini, this time with more of a creepy feel!
As usual, Domini's graphics are fabulous, very detailed, and vivid. Their design of faces, both making them all unique and realistic, is constantly improving. They've really mastered adding natural lines to faces to age them, something not many developers have achieved well or gracefully. The realism of the designed characters is improving all the time. Sometimes I just marvel at it.
This game has a creepy vibe but not overly so. It isn't an asylum vibe or anything, and in a new twist, the "horror" involves swimming pools! There's a lot of attention to detail, and if you click around on random objects in scenes, you'll find a good jump scare or two and fun little movements, something that has become an entertaining hallmark of Domini games.
The collectibles are sometimes tricky, sometimes easy, all findable. In general scenes, we need to find dolls and runes (they kind of look like matis/Greek evil eyes to me), and both kinds morph. In the closeups, it's snapshots.
I really like the concept behind this game and the plot. Really nice change and a good combo of factors involved. I won't spoil it for you.
And now for a PSA: If you don't like Domini Games, stop playing them. The complaints are the same over and over again. The developer is what it is, and that's not going to change. These are never going to be some Elder Scrolls-level games with brand-new items and concepts in every game, so don't expect something other than what you know you're going to get. Part of the problem seems to be that so many developers' games aside from Domini got negative reviews from many of these same people and for many of the same reasons (they like to say all old games are better than the new ones, but they complained about the same things in the past on other developers' games), that most developers have jumped ship. In all past games, no matter the developer, we've needed to find screwdrivers, we have had broken keys in locks, and we've needed a valve. That's just how it is. Because of these ongoing complaints that started years ago and have included most developers' games, all we have left now is pretty much Domini and poorly remastered games—don't ruin it for all the many people who still love Domini. If they stop making HOPs, Big Fish will have no HOP developers left.
Reviewers are so busy raining down fire on Domini Games simply for the purpose of hating on the developer (note: when they first called themselves Do Games, the reviewers were much kinder and more generous and liked the game; when they figured out Do Games was Domini, the hate became unreal), they missed the actual mistakes. There were a couple of sloppy mistakes in this game, which is why my rating dropped from 5 stars to 4 stars. For example, a repeated line of spoken dialogue that replaced what was supposed to be a different line, and something in our inventory called the wrong name (I think it was a scoop being called a spatula). These aren't game ruiners, they just mean the developer could use some more careful quality control.
This game is a fun one—judge for yourself in the demo instead of reading the broken-record bad reviews. Keep it up, Domini. Show less

Some scenes you have a teal sky and teal ground. It's moldy and terrible. I'd rather the purple and pinks. The teal took away any enjoyment.
It has 4 chapters + bonus and it's very long. I took a week to finish. I just couldn't play for long at a time. If you just want something to do and a long game this is it.
Again no outlines on the plus items.
I kept wondering what the blonde's deal was. I was 3/4 done until I found out.
I really liked the collectibles. I found 15 dolls, 15 runes and not all of the 59 snapshots. I missed one and the map didn't show it like it should. The Boudoir starts out broken down and when you purchase it's a different item fixed up.
The hops are more puzzle like. I like regular but I did like the morphing hops. Most hops were too dark to see even if you use the brightness option. It has English mistakes like calling a clock a watch. Instead of a Dutch oven it has a Russian oven which was a wicker basket.
Relays on 26 videos, 20 out of 21 hops, 18 mini-games and 5 music. (one hop is locked up after bonus chapter). Show less
